    Italy Nanobiosensors In Healthcare Market Summary

    The Italy Nanobiosensors in Healthcare market is poised for substantial growth, projected to reach 35 USD Million by 2035.

    Key Market Trends & Highlights

    Italy Nanobiosensors in Healthcare Key Trends and Highlights

    • The market valuation for Italy Nanobiosensors in Healthcare stands at 9.75 USD Million in 2024.
    • From 2025 to 2035, the market is expected to grow at a compound annual growth rate of 12.32%.
    • By 2035, the market is anticipated to expand to 35 USD Million, indicating robust growth potential.
    • Growing adoption of nanobiosensors due to advancements in diagnostic capabilities is a major market driver.

    Market Size & Forecast

    2024 Market Size 9.75 (USD Million)
    2035 Market Size 35 (USD Million)
    CAGR (2025-2035) 12.32%

    Nanobiosensors in Healthcare Market Type Insights

    Nanobiosensors in Healthcare Market Type Insights

    The Italy Nanobiosensors in Healthcare Market iscapturing significant attention due to innovative applications across various healthcare sectors, particularly through Type segmentation. This market comprises Optical Nanobiosensors, Electrochemical Nanobiosensors, and Acoustic Nanobiosensors, each contributing uniquely to the healthcare landscape. Optical Nanobiosensors utilize light for detecting biological elements and are crucial in diagnostics, showcasing their importance in providing real-time analysis with high sensitivity. Their role in point-of-care testing devices particularly highlights their potential patient outcomes through timely interventions.

    On the other hand, Electrochemical Nanobiosensors are known for their effective transduction mechanisms and are particularly favored for their ability to measure concentration levels of biomolecules. They find vast applications in monitoring chronic diseases, making them indispensable in the management of diabetes and cardiovascular conditions. Their integration into wearable technology further emphasizes the growing trend of personalized medicine and continuous health monitoring among patients in Italy.

    Acoustic Nanobiosensors, while less prevalent than the other types, are emerging prominently due to their label-free detection methods, which reduce the complexity often associated with other biosensing techniques. Their significance lies in applications requiring specific binding interactions, making them valuable for early disease detection and the monitoring of therapeutic responses.

    Nanobiosensors in Healthcare Market Application Insights

    Nanobiosensors in Healthcare Market Application Insights

    The Application segment of the Italy Nanobiosensors in Healthcare Market encompasses critical areas such as Diabetes, Immunoassay, Cancer detection, and Pathogenic Bacteria monitoring. The growing prevalence of diabetes in Italy emphasizes the significant role of nanobiosensors in glucose monitoring and management, facilitating timely medical interventions. Immunoassays are becoming increasingly vital for early disease diagnosis and monitoring, showing a rise in demand due to their high sensitivity and specificity. Cancer detection is another prominent application; with Italy having a notable number of cancer cases, employing advanced nanobiosensors can enhance screening processes and improve patient outcomes.

    Furthermore, the focus on pathogenic bacteria detection highlights the importance of rapid and accurate diagnostics in combatting infectious diseases, aligning with Italy's public health initiatives to manage outbreaks effectively. Each of these applications not only showcases the versatility of nanobiosensors but also supports the ongoing advancements in personalized medicine, leading to improved healthcare delivery across the nation.
